Bagikan melalui


ItemsRepeater.ElementIndexChanged Kejadian

Definisi

Terjadi untuk setiap UIElement yang direalisasikan ketika indeks untuk item yang diwakilinya telah berubah.

// Register
event_token ElementIndexChanged(TypedEventHandler<ItemsRepeater, ItemsRepeaterElementIndexChangedEventArgs const&> const& handler) const;

// Revoke with event_token
void ElementIndexChanged(event_token const* cookie) const;

// Revoke with event_revoker
ItemsRepeater::ElementIndexChanged_revoker ElementIndexChanged(auto_revoke_t, TypedEventHandler<ItemsRepeater, ItemsRepeaterElementIndexChangedEventArgs const&> const& handler) const;
public event TypedEventHandler<ItemsRepeater,ItemsRepeaterElementIndexChangedEventArgs> ElementIndexChanged;
function onElementIndexChanged(eventArgs) { /* Your code */ }
itemsRepeater.addEventListener("elementindexchanged", onElementIndexChanged);
itemsRepeater.removeEventListener("elementindexchanged", onElementIndexChanged);
- or -
itemsRepeater.onelementindexchanged = onElementIndexChanged;
Public Custom Event ElementIndexChanged As TypedEventHandler(Of ItemsRepeater, ItemsRepeaterElementIndexChangedEventArgs) 

Jenis Acara

Keterangan

Saat Anda menggunakan ItemsRepeater untuk membangun kontrol yang lebih kompleks yang mendukung interaksi tertentu pada elemen anak (seperti pilihan atau klik), akan berguna untuk dapat menyimpan pengidentifikasi terbaru untuk item data pendukung.

Peristiwa ini dimunculkan untuk setiap UIElement yang diwujudkan di mana indeks untuk item yang diwakilinya telah berubah. Misalnya, ketika item lain ditambahkan atau dihapus di sumber data, indeks untuk item yang datang setelah dalam urutan akan terpengaruh.

Berlaku untuk